Why Autumn Demands a Workwear Refresh

Unlike summer’s breezy styles or winter’s heavy layers, autumn is unpredictable. Mornings can be chilly, afternoons warmer, and evenings breezy again. That’s why the art of autumn workwear lies in layering—building outfits that adapt as the day unfolds. 

Light knits, structured blazers, versatile dresses, and statement coats become the building blocks of your office looks. And the best part? Each piece can be styled in multiple ways, so your wardrobe feels fresh without needing endless options.

Core Pieces Every Woman Needs for Autumn Workwear

1. Light Sweaters & Cardigans: The Cozy Essentials

When the air turns crisp, nothing beats slipping into a soft knit. Sweaters for women in neutral shades and light fabric are ideal for a clean and polished office look. Pair them with tailored trousers or pencil skirts, and you’re good to go. 

For slightly warmer days, pre-winter cardigans for women are a lifesaver. They act as the perfect layering piece—easy to slip on during chilly mornings and take off when the sun peeks through. Opt for cropped styles with dresses or longline cardigans over slim-fit pants for a chic silhouette.

2. Outer Layers: Blazers, Jackets & Coats

When it comes to professional polish, blazers for women are unbeatable. A classic black blazer instantly sharpens your look, while bold colors or plaid patterns can add character to your autumn wardrobe. On cooler days, a long coat or a trendy shacket (shirt-jacket hybrid) keeps you warm without compromising style. 

For those who commute, a neutral camel or navy overcoat layers beautifully over both formal and casual office outfits. Think of these pieces as your armor—structured, sophisticated, and versatile enough to carry you from boardroom meetings to after-work dinners.

3. Bottoms & One-Piece Wonders

No autumn wardrobe is complete without reliable trousers for women. High-waist, straight-leg, or wide-leg trousers provide endless styling possibilities and work beautifully with both sweaters and blazers. On days when you want fuss-free dressing, dresses for women step in as the ultimate office-ready outfit. 

Autumn dresses or maxi dresses are particularly autumn-friendly—easy to layer with tights, cardigans, or blazers for a smart finish. And if you love streamlined looks, co-ords or jumpsuits paired with outerwear can make you look polished with minimum effort.

How to Build Your Autumn Workwear Capsule

The key to autumn dressing is creating a flexible capsule wardrobe:

  • Base Layers: Light winter tops or thin knits that work on their own.

  • Mid Layers: Lightweight Cardigans or sweaters for adjustable warmth.

  • Outer Layers: Blazers, coats, or shackets for added structure.

  • Bottoms: Versatile trousers, skirts, or tailored jeans.

  • Statement Pieces: Dresses or co-ords for effortless style.

Stick to a neutral color palette—black, navy, beige—and add pops of autumn tones like rust, burgundy, or forest green to keep things seasonal yet professional.

FAQs

What colors are best for autumn workwear?
Earthy tones like camel, rust, burgundy, forest green, and neutrals such as black, navy, and beige are timeless for fall office outfits.

2. Can I wear dresses in autumn for work?
Absolutely! Opt for sweater dresses or midi dresses layered with blazers or cardigans to stay warm and office-appropriate.

How can I layer for autumn without looking bulky?
Start with light base layers, add a slim cardigan or knit, and finish with a structured blazer. Keeping proportions balanced ensures you look sharp.

What footwear works best with autumn workwear?
Loafers, ankle boots, and block heels are practical yet stylish options that complement both trousers and dresses.

Is it okay to wear denim to the office in autumn?
Yes, especially on casual Fridays. Pair dark-wash jeans with a smart blazer or cardigan to strike the right balance between relaxed and professional.
